What is a multi engine pilot?

Multi engine pilots are licensed aviators trained and certified to operate aircraft equipped with more than one engine. They possess specialized knowledge and skills to handle the complexities of multi engine aircraft, such as managing engine failures, asymmetric thrust, and advanced systems. Multi engine pilots typically undergo additional training and testing beyond the requirements for single engine pilots. They are often employed in commercial aviation, corporate flight departments, and charter services where multi engine planes are commonly used.

What does a multi engine pilot do?

A multi-engine pilot is a pilot with credentials that allow them to operate an aircraft with more than one engine. The Federal Aviation Administration (FAA) has a recommended syllabus for institutions offering this training. As a pilot with the multi-engine land (MEL) rating, you can fly larger planes, whether as a private or commercial operator. You must perform several duties before and after flights, including inspection of the airplane, flight plan submission, and maintenance of safe operation during flight. Federal regulations dictate the maximum amount of hours you can fly, but you typically work outside of the standard 9-to-5 weekday schedule.

What are some common challenges faced by multi engine pilots during flight operations?

Multi engine pilots often encounter challenges such as managing asymmetric thrust during engine failures, coordinating complex cockpit procedures, and staying proficient with emergency checklists. Operating larger, faster aircraft also requires strong situational awareness and communication skills, especially when working with co-pilots and air traffic control. Regular training and clear communication are essential for safely handling the increased workload and potential in-flight issues unique to multi engine operations.

Position: Fixed Wing Pilot
Location: Wichita, KA
Airframe: King Air C90/200
Schedule: 7 Days On and 7 Days Off or 14 On and 14 Off
Annual Salary Range: $94,850.77 - $104,335.85
  • 15,000 Sign-On Bonus (Must Complete Training and Check-Ride).
  • 40,000 Retention Bonus (There is a 6 Month Waiting Period and This is a 3 Year Program).
  • Up to 3,000 in Relocation Assistance.
  • Company Paid Crew Housing.

We're hiring a fixed wing King Air C90/200 Pilot to provide medical air transportation services to our customers. This pilot will be qualified to fly our King Airplanes. Scheduled shifts run 7/7 or 14/14 and service day or night trips. Safety is a key pillar of our services; therefore, all of our pilots work on a quality, professional team that are committed to high safety standards for the crew and our customers.
Responsibilities:
  • Pilot will work with a team of medical experts to safely transport customers to and from locations and facilities.
  • Ensure aircraft readiness for flight dispatches as described in the appropriate manuals, including all FAR and company requirements, and aircraft cleanliness duties.
  • Maintain accurate company and regulatory documentation and record keeping for shifts, load manifests, etc.
  • Effectively communicate and collaborate with both air and ground dispatch, flight crews, facilities and partners.
  • Provide shift change info to transitioning pilot and team and follows protocols for recording company change board details.
  • Pilots are accountable to maintain required certifications and ongoing ground and air training.

Minimum Required Qualifications
  • Commercial Airplane Multi Engine Land (C-AMEL) Required.
  • Must be willing and able to obtain ATP within 5 years of employment.
  • The ideal candidate will have single pilot IFR experience.
  • Ability to provide logbooks listing all flight dates and corresponding hours, along with a cumulative total that substantiates the time reported on the resume.
  • Previous medevac and/or cargo experience preferred.
  • Valid and unexpired driver's license.
  • Current FAA First or Second Class Medical Certificate.
  • 2,500 Total Flight hours.
  • 1,000 PIC hours.
  • 500 Cross Country hours.
  • 500 Multi-Engine hours.
  • 100 Night hours.
  • 75 Instrument (50 actual) hours.

Preferred Education:
  • Minimum of a High School Diploma, GED equivalent, or higher.

Working Conditions:
  • Required to work in outside weather conditions.
  • May need to deice the plane, assist with towing the aircraft and maneuvering in and out of the hangar, prep the plane for flight.
